Wall Street Zen lowered FuelCell Energy (NASDAQ:FCEL) to a sell rating from hold on Sunday. This downgrade follows the company's latest quarterly financial report.
FuelCell Energy reported a loss of $0.53 per share. This result missed the analyst consensus estimate of a $0.52 loss. Quarterly revenue reached $35.59 million. This figure fell short of the $40.47 million expected by Wall Street.
The broader analyst consensus for the company remains a hold. Analysts maintain an average price target of $22.83 for the stock. Shares opened at $20.43 on Friday.
